Ingredients
Let’s get started! Here’s what you’ll need to make your own Pumpkin, Spinach and Feta Muffins:
- 1 cup pureed pumpkin
- 1 cup fresh spinach, chopped
- 1 cup feta cheese, crumbled
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tablespo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 2 large eggs
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1/4 cup olive oil
Step-by-Step Instructions
- Preheat Your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). This ensures the muffins bake evenly.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the flour, baking powder, salt, and black pepper. Whisk them together to prevent any lumps.
- Prepare the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, whisk together the pureed pumpkin, chopped spinach, crumbled feta, eggs, milk, and olive oil until well combined.
- Combine Mixtures: Pour the wet mixture into the dry ingredients. Gently stir until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, as you want to keep the muffins fluffy.
- Fill Muffin Tins: Line a muffin tin with liners or lightly grease it. Spoon the batter into each muffin cup, filling them about 2/3 full.
- Bake: Place the muffin tin in the preheated oven. Bake for 20 to 25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
- Cool Down: Once baked, let the muffins cool in the tin for about 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ack. This will help achieve that perfect texture!
Top Tips for Perfecting Pumpkin, Spinach and Feta Muffins
- Substitutions: If you want to spice things up, consider adding some cooked, crumbled halal-friendly chicken sausage or swapping out the feta for goat cheese for a different flavor profile.
- Timing is Key: Make sure not to overbake your muffins; otherwise, they may become dry. Start checking them at the 20-minute mark.
- Avoid Common Mistakes: Ensure your baking powder is fresh for optimal rising—stale baking powder can lead to dense muffins.
Storing and Reheating Tips
To maintain the freshness of your Pumpkin, Spinach and Feta Muffins,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days or freeze them for up to 3 months.
Reheating:
- Refrigerated Muffins: Warm them in a microwave for about 15-20 seconds or place them in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5-10 minutes.
- Frozen Muffins: Th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at as mentioned above.
